This photo(thats me on the left) came from a newspaper article of a movie that was made about us a few yrs ago..We had Anthrax play there a few times with other bands like Nuclear Assault..Like I mentioned Metallica and as in this picture Slayer..We had other local bands play there probably once a month.We used to house all the bands that came around.I partied with KIng Diamond,Venom,Carnivore which was Peter Steele's(band)which became Type O Negative.Raven,OverKill,And many others I can't recall.One thing I remember was my friend eating an glass only to be upstaged by Kronos of Venom eating a shotglass..We would start the party friday night an limp home sunday evening..I was the security..We would have a few hundred people come on out for some of the gigs..It was mad..I would say I have been in over 200 fights.A few of my friends roadied for Metallica.They worked for them when the equipment truck was stolen with all their gear in Boston..I remember when they booted Mustane.He was a good guy but it seemed he could not perform unless he was smashed.Not well either..I liked Dave..We didn't warm up to Kirk and his poofy hair style to easily..He did not fit In our opinion.Cliff was the best..They used my friends house as a east coast home base.They would leave their truck there a little pc of crap import.We wrecked it..we used to pull a canoe around the property with it for canoe rides..
